July 2024 - 04:30. philips duramax 45w flood br30WebMay 6, 2015 · According to Deb, the very best book on bunads is Norsk Bunadleksikon by Bjørb Sverre Hol Haugen. It is a three-volume encyclopedia of over 500 different bunads of Norway. Each volume covers different regions in Norway and provides the history and description of each bunad. The national female bunad of Norway consists of an embroidered blouse, a long skirt, a bodice, a shawl, an apron (in some regions), a headdress, a purse, a belt, stockings, shoes, and silver jewelry. There is a great variety of women’s outfits but all of them are very beautiful, feminine, and intricately embellished. truth calvin klein menWebApr 24, 2024 · Bunad – beautiful national outfit of Norway.
